While staying in a hotel with a kitchen in Tochigi Prefecture, you have the opportunity to prepare a variety of local dishes that showcase regional flavors. Some popular options include 'Nikko yuba,' which features tofu skin, and 'Soba' noodles, which can be made fresh or cooked quickly. Additionally, you can experiment with seasonal vegetables and local fish available in the area. Trying your hand at creating a traditional Japanese meal can enhance your travel experience and allow you to savor Tochigi's culinary offerings.
